Prime Minister Narendra Modi who arrived in Chennai earlier yesterday to address the 10th edition of Defence Expo was greeted with black balloons and black flags. The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am (DMK) floated a black balloon with the slogan 'Modi Go Back' as a sign of their protest against Modi Government for not constituting the Cauvery Management Board (CMB).

DMK shared a photo of its President M Karunanidhi, where he can be seen wearing black at his Chennai resident as a mark of protest against the visit of the Prime Minister. The non-compliance of the Supreme Court's February 16 order on setting up CMB has triggered protests across the state.

#GoBackModi trends worldwide
Following the protests, #GoBackModi was trending worldwide on Twitter yesterday for a while. More than 1.3 lakh tweets had been sent out with the hashtag by Thursday afternoon.
